Fixing That Annoying White Halo: 5 Tools That Actually Clean PNG Edges Fast

Turn Haloed Images into Crisp PNGs in 30 Minutes

Have you ever downloaded a PNG and found a soft white glow around the subject that ruins the clean cutout look? You're not alone. That halo can come from uneven backgrounds, poor masking, or compression artifacts. This tutorial shows you how to stop accepting fuzzy edges as "good enough." In 30 minutes you'll: identify the root cause, choose one of five practical tools, run a focused cleanup workflow, and export a ready-to-use PNG with clean edges and correct color blending.

Is this for total beginners or experienced designers? Both. I'll walk through simple auto fixes and deep repairs. Want instant automation for many images? I'll show you the fastest option. Need pixel-perfect results for print or product shots? I'll give the manual steps pros use.

Before You Start: Files, Software, and Expectations for Edge Cleanup

What do you need before you begin? Gather these items so you won't stop mid-task:

    Original high-resolution image (preferably the source file, not a compressed JPEG) Access to at least one of the five tools below: Instant PNG, remove.bg, Photopea, Photoshop, or GIMP Basic understanding of layers and alpha channels helps but is not required An eye for color shifts - you'll need to decide whether to keep a natural color fringe or neutralize it Time: 5 minutes for fast auto tools, 15-30 minutes for careful manual fixes

Which tool should you pick right now? Ask yourself: Do I need speed or precision? For bulk, automation wins. For hair, glass, or intricate edges, manual tools give better control.

Tools and file formats to prefer

    Work with PNG-24 or PSD when possible. Avoid repeated JPEG saves. Keep an unflattened master - you'll thank yourself when you need to tweak edges later. If you must deliver web images, save a web-optimized PNG after cleanup.

Your PNG Cleanup Roadmap: 7 Steps from Source Photo to Clean Edge

This is a practical route you can use with any of the five tools. Follow all steps, but skip or compress ones that your chosen tool handles automatically.

image

Step 1 - Diagnose the Halo: What type of fringe are you seeing?

Is it a white glow, a colored fringe, or a soft feather? Zoom to 200% and check the alpha edge. White halos often mean the background color bled into the matte during a poor mask or export. Colored fringing comes from chroma spill when the subject was shot against a saturated backdrop.

image

Step 2 - Try the instant fix for a quick result

Use an automatic removal like Instant PNG download or remove.bg to get a baseline PNG. Does it remove most of the halo? If yes, open the resulting PNG in a pixel editor and inspect the edges before final export.

Step 3 - Use edge refinement tools

If you use Photopea or Photoshop, run Select and Mask or Refine Edge. Adjust the radius, shift edge (contract slightly), and use decontaminate colors if available. In GIMP, use the Select > Grow/Shrink and feather tools followed by Layer Mask painting to tidy the edge.

Step 4 - Remove color fringing with manual matte techniques

Create a new transparent layer under the subject and fill it with a mid-gray. This exposes troublesome color fringes. Use a brush with low opacity on the layer mask to paint out the fringe, or run a short script to replace fringe color with neutral tones. In Photoshop, try Layer > Matting > Defringe with 1-2 pixels.

Step 5 - Tighten or soften the edge

If the cut looks too hard, use a tiny amount of feather - 0.3 to 1.5 pixels is usually enough for screen assets. If the cut is still haloed, apply a negative shift edge (contract) by 1-2 pixels, then lightly feather to blend.

Step 6 - Check against different backgrounds

Preview the PNG on white, black, and a mid-tone background. Does a subtle halo reappear on any of them? If so, revisit the matte and color decontamination steps until the edge behaves consistently across contrasts.

Step 7 - Export with the right settings

Export as PNG-24 with full alpha. If your delivery allows, save both a PNG and a layered master. For web, use a compressed PNG or next-gen format after confirming the alpha preserved the clean edge.

A Real Comparison: The Five Tools That Cut White Halos (and When to Use Each)

Tool Speed Best for Limitations Instant PNG download Very fast Bulk quick removals, non-critical web assets May leave subtle halos, limited manual control remove.bg Fast Quick background removal for portraits Struggles with semi-transparent edges and glass Photopea Moderate Free web-based manual refinement Performance depends on browser and file size Photoshop (Select and Mask) Moderate Precision edge work, hair, soft materials Subscription cost GIMP Moderate to slow Free manual control for budget workflows Less intuitive edge tools than Photoshop

Avoid These 5 Everyday Mistakes That Make Halos Worse

    Exporting with a flattened matte: Saving as flattened PNG or JPEG can blur the alpha into a visible halo. Always export with preserved transparency when possible. Over-relying on automatic removal: Speed is great, but auto tools may leave a color fringe behind. Always inspect edges on contrasting backgrounds. Too much feathering: Heavy feathering creates a visible white wash around dark subjects on bright backgrounds. Use tiny feather amounts and test on various backgrounds. Ignoring color decontamination: If the subject was shot on a colored backdrop, not removing spill will keep a tint that looks like a halo. Relying on only one zoom level: Pixels lie. Check at 25% and 200% so you see both overall appearance and pixel-level artifacts.

Pro Designer Methods: Advanced Edge Control and Color Matting Tricks

Want pro-level results? Here are techniques that separate good cutouts from great ones.

Use channel masks for clean separation

Does the subject contrast strongly on one color channel? Duplicate the best channel, boost contrast using Levels, and use that as a selection. This gives tighter edges than RGB-based selection tools on tricky subjects.

Paint a custom alpha for hair and soft edges

Create a grayscale alpha channel and paint hair details with a small soft brush at low opacity. Blending painted translucency with real image pixels reproduces natural edge softness without haloing.

Matte trimming with a two-step contract-feather routine

Contract the selection by 1-2 pixels, apply a tiny feather, then refine. This removes bleed while preserving a natural-looking border.

Color replacement for fringe removal

When fringe shows a background color, select the fringe area newsbreak.com on its own layer and sample neutral mid-tones from the subject. Use low-opacity brush strokes to neutralize ringed pixels without destroying texture.

Batch processing without losing quality

If you have 200 product shots, run Instant PNG or remove.bg to create initial masks, then batch open results in Photopea or Photoshop to run a recorded action that applies a 1-pixel contract and 0.5-pixel feather. This scales fast and keeps consistent results.

When Auto-Remove Fails: How to Rescue a Broken PNG

What if the instant tool produces a PNG with an ugly halo? Don't throw the file away. Try these rescue steps.

Step A - Rebuild the alpha from the RGB

Open the PNG in Photopea or Photoshop. Create a new channel, paste a luminance copy of the RGB, then use Levels to isolate subject vs background. Load that channel as a selection and apply it as the layer mask. You'll often remove leftover artifacts by forcing a fresh mask.

Step B - Use "Defringe" or manual color replace

Photoshop's Layer > Matting > Defringe with 1-2 pixels often kills a white halo. If you don't have that command, sample halo color and paint along the mask edge at low opacity until the fringe disappears.

Step C - Reconstruct missing semi-transparency

If hair or glass looks chopped after aggressive trimming, use the original image as a second layer and blend it with the cleaned mask using a soft mask brush to rebuild translucency selectively.

Step D - Compare on multiple backgrounds

Final test: place your image on white, black, and a gradient. If any background reveals an edge problem, refine the mask where it shows up. This is faster than guesswork.

Tools and Resources

    Instant PNG download: Quick bulk PNGs with auto mask. Great first pass for many images. remove.bg: Fast portrait and simple object removal. Watch for thin hair and transparency errors. Photopea: Free, web-based Photoshop-like app. Perfect for quick manual fixes without installs. Photoshop: Industry standard. Use Select and Mask, Channel-based masks, and Defringe. GIMP: Free desktop editor. Use layer masks and channel tools for manual corrections. Helpful tutorials: Search for "alpha channel hair masking tutorial" or "defringe photoshop" for step-by-step videos specific to hair and glass.

Quick Checklist Before You Deliver

    Is the alpha preserved? (Exported PNG-24) Does the subject look correct on white, black, and mid-tone backgrounds? Are translucent edges natural, not chopped or over-feathered? Is the color fringe removed without desaturating the subject? Did you save a layered master in case the client requests tweaks?

Final Thoughts: When to Use Instant Automation and When to Manually Repair

Auto tools like Instant PNG download save hours on bulk jobs and work well for many web and social images. But they won't match thoughtful manual masking for delicate subjects like hair, fur, or glass. My rule: use instant tools for initial passes and low-stakes assets; switch to manual workflows when the subject or audience demands high polish.

Need help choosing a specific workflow for a tricky image? Send a brief description or a small sample and I'll recommend which of the five tools will give you the best balance of speed and quality.